## Deployment

The nightly reindex for Quillhaven Search runs as a scheduled job on the batch cluster, kicking off at 02:00 local cluster time. It rebuilds the full document index from the primary store, swaps aliases atomically, and retains the previous index for one cycle as a rollback target. Reviewers should check that index mapping changes are backward compatible, since the swap is all-or-nothing. The job reads its parameters from the values below.

settings of bahip-yagef:
zorvan:
  pin: 0198
  tenant: caswyn
  seal: seal_a58b6b6a
  metrics_host: metrics.zorvan.sivrelnet.local
  standby_team: silwyn
  escalation: rusvan-gilox
  nonce: 477a13

Subject: TideGlass widget cut-over complete

Hi Marit,

The cut-over of the TideGlass tide-table widget to the new Harborline prediction service finished at 04:20 local with no dropped sessions. We verified tide curves for all twelve Pelbury Bay stations against the legacy feed; deltas stayed under two centimetres. Caching now defaults to fifteen-minute windows, and the fallback renderer was retired as planned. Rollback scripts remain staged for seventy-two hours. For your records, the production configuration now in effect is as follows.

config for kajog-tadug:
[casax]
port = 11211
region = west-3
host = casax.nelvroworks.internal
timeout_ms = 5000
retries = 7

Ticket: Haulstone fleet fuel-usage report blocked — the Q3 aggregation job can't read the metrics vault after last week's rotation, and the report page shows stale numbers. Future maintainers: the vault auto-locks after three failed unseals; don't retry blindly. Re-run the job only after unsealing succeeds. To unseal the vault manually, enter the recovery passphrase noted directly below.

unlock words, yawig-kagef: gordor-holvan-ulaael-pramir-ulaiel-tamdor